2.
I
have directed an account
of the preliminary religious Ceremony and the subsequent proceedings to be compiled from the local papers, and Your Lordship will perceive that I availed myself of
the
opportunity
to
place before the Chinese the obligations,
which they might be regarded as having undertaken, and reminded
them of the
position which they would occupy in future, enjoying great freedom in all matters of local details, and management, but subject to the general superintendence and visits of certain Government officers.
3.
At the same time I felt
it right to pay
a
just tribute to the exertions of the Committee, who have been indefatigable in urging on the work, and who have not
merely raised
amongst
their
countrymen donations exceeding
$40,000 for the actual construction of the building, but have also obtained a list of annual Subscribers pledged to contribute $7000 yearly to the expenses.
